Do I have to have a lawyer for my ex to sign over his rights to my children?

Question

Do I have to have a lawyer for my ex to sign over his rights to my children?



Answer

There is no such thing as "signing over rights" except as part of an adoption. Parties may, with court approval, be able to modify visitation and custody in some cases. It is virtually impossible to do that correctly and successfully without counsel.
